I could see them doing Comrade if it had a downside or two. That way, adding another color to a commander is a process you have to think about. I've seen various versions of adding one color to a commander that had starting hand size reduced by one, skip their first draw step, or increasing the casting cost of the commander by 1 of the new color. I've dabbled on the idea, that gave your opponents X thing where X was the number of times you cast the main commander that game.
tl;dr: I think it's possible to add a color if some downsides went with the decision.
I specifically think the piper would be fine paired with any deck. The design space for being able to graft a commander onto any deck is going to be very small, though. Partners designed to be partners are already weaker than normal commanders. How anemic would they have to be to partner with any commander? There's also the combo problem. Huge swathes of commander designs will be super problematic to partner with any legendary creature ever to exist. The piper, however, is a vanilla 3/3 for 5. It's easily the worst card in your entire deck and would simply be an emblem that gives you an optional extra color for the most part.
